Transaction 412505006fa9c935a30a4d7aac77a79de762e9673edc8430aaf00efaf561140b

1 Input
2 Outputs
  • 412505006fa9c935a30a4d7aac77a79de762e9673edc8430aaf00efaf561140b:0
  • value  25352
    address  3EDZ9FRhanMoV3X6KwUQimNBbbnH1EhNgg
  • 412505006fa9c935a30a4d7aac77a79de762e9673edc8430aaf00efaf561140b:1
  • value  132884
    address  bc1q4l8df4qm7ws5qakj670rfzpzgxvyu5z9e8ptnt